Huntington Park is fortunate to be the home of an existing shopping district along Pacific Boulevard that features over 600 businesses of many varieties specializing in electronics, furniture, apparel, jewelry, and appliances. Huntington Park is proud to have the following businesses located in our community: Home Depot, La Curacao Electronics, FAMSA Furniture Store, Deardens, Staples, Bally Total Fitness, and Starbucks to name but just a few. We also are proud of Alexander BMW, Sopp Chevrolet and Sopp Ford.
Huntington Park is also one of the cities within the Alameda Corridor, a 20 mile high-speed railroad freight line connecting the ports of Long Beach and Los Angeles. The Alameda Corridor is a faster, more efficient way to move cargo and improves the flow of traffic by eliminating conflicts at nearly 200 crossings and by adding turn lanes.
